What are the objectives of recruitment?

Short Answer

The objectives of recruitment are to attract and encourage suitable candidates to apply for job vacancies in an organization. It aims to create a pool of qualified applicants so that the best person can be selected for the job. Recruitment ensures that the organization gets skilled employees.

In simple words, recruitment is done to find the right people for the right jobs at the right time. It helps in providing enough candidates, improving hiring quality, and supporting the overall goals of the organization.

Objectives of Recruitment in Organization

Recruitment is an important function of Human Resource Management. Its main purpose is to identify job needs and attract suitable candidates to fill those positions. It is not only about filling vacancies but also about achieving long-term organizational success by hiring the right talent.

The objectives of recruitment help organizations maintain a steady supply of skilled employees and ensure smooth functioning of all departments. A proper recruitment process reduces hiring problems and improves workforce quality.

To Attract Qualified Candidates

One of the main objectives of recruitment is to attract qualified and skilled candidates for job openings. Organizations try to reach people who have the required education, experience, and skills for the job.

By using different recruitment sources like advertisements, online job portals, and campus interviews, companies ensure that a large number of suitable applicants apply for the job. This increases the chances of selecting the best candidate.

To Create a Pool of Applicants

Recruitment aims to create a pool of applicants from which the organization can select the most suitable person. A larger pool of candidates gives more options to the employer.

This helps in comparing different candidates based on their skills, knowledge, and experience. A good pool of applicants improves the quality of selection and reduces the risk of wrong hiring decisions.

To Select Right Candidate for Right Job

Another important objective of recruitment is to ensure that the right person is selected for the right job. When recruitment is done properly, it helps in matching job requirements with candidate abilities.

This leads to better job performance and higher satisfaction among employees. It also reduces employee turnover because people are placed in roles that suit their skills.

To Reduce Cost of Hiring

Recruitment also aims to reduce the cost of hiring employees. A proper recruitment process helps in screening candidates effectively so that only suitable applicants move forward in the selection process.

This saves time and money for the organization. When recruitment is efficient, there is less need for repeated hiring and training, which reduces overall recruitment expenses.

To Support Organizational Growth

One of the key objectives of recruitment is to support the growth and expansion of the organization. As companies grow, they need more employees to handle increased work.

Recruitment ensures that the organization always has enough manpower to meet its needs. It helps in providing skilled employees for new projects, departments, and business expansion.

To Improve Employee Performance

Recruitment helps in improving employee performance by selecting skilled and capable individuals. When the right candidates are hired, they are more likely to perform their duties effectively.

Good performance leads to higher productivity and better results for the organization. This helps in achieving organizational goals in an efficient manner.

To Maintain Continuous Supply of Manpower

Another objective of recruitment is to ensure a continuous supply of manpower in the organization. Employees may leave due to retirement, resignation, or other reasons.

Recruitment ensures that there is always a replacement available for vacant positions. This helps in maintaining smooth business operations without interruptions.

To Enhance Organizational Image

Recruitment also helps in improving the image of the organization. A fair and transparent recruitment process creates a positive impression among job seekers.

When candidates feel that the organization treats applicants fairly, more talented individuals are attracted to apply. This improves the reputation of the company in the job market.

To Encourage Diversity in Workforce

Modern recruitment also aims to bring diversity into the workplace. By hiring people from different backgrounds, skills, and experiences, organizations can improve creativity and innovation.

A diverse workforce helps in better problem solving and decision making, which benefits the organization in the long run.
